//
// MeshCal and our internal Roster service both think they own the
// "team standup" events, so we resolve conflicts by last-writer-wins
// keyed on the Roster revision stamp. Yes, that occasionally eats a
// manual edit someone made in MeshCal; that's the documented tradeoff,
// see the design note in the wiki. Don't "fix" it by disabling the
// stamp check — that caused the duplicate-event storm last spring.
// The client below talks to Roster and needs its internal key, pasted here.

gateway credential: kto23_LX9A4ys6i4nzHtpOLNLodKK

Subject: Timeweaver cut-over — done!

Hi all,

Quick recap for the newer folks: over the weekend we moved the school timetable solver from the old Grindstone cluster to Timeweaver v2. All of Ashfell District's schedules re-solved cleanly, and solve times dropped from ~40 minutes to under 6. The only hiccup was a stale constraint cache, which Priya flushed Sunday night. Old endpoints are dark as of this morning, so point everything at the new service. For reference, the solver now runs with the following configuration:

deployment values, taweg-bajop:
[fenvan]
port = 5672
team = holmir
host = fenvan.orvexio.example
region = lower-1
access_code = ac_b98bc6
timeout_ms = 1500

## Onboarding — Markdown Pipeline (Inkmere)

Inkmere docs render through a three-stage pipeline: parse, sanitize, emit. Releases rebuild all templates; never hot-patch emitted HTML. Broken renders usually mean a sanitizer rule change — check the rules diff first. The render cluster only accepts builds from the release channel, and every build artifact must be signed before upload. Sign artifacts with the deploy key below.

release key, hafop-tajef: bky13_s2vaFVNJTHfBL

[ ] Thumbnail queue — Pellworth Media 2.8

Verify worker pool drains cleanly on deploy. Confirm retry backoff capped at five attempts; poison items route to dead-letter. Check queue depth alert thresholds updated for new sharding. Regenerate sample thumbnails across all three size presets and spot-check output. Ensure old-format entries are migrated before cutover, not after. Rollback plan: re-point consumers to the 2.7 queue, no data loss expected. Sign-off requires a green soak run; the qualifying build is recorded under the token below.

trace token, kaduf-kadup: htk14_d0223cc3c18e70